PNP386841 An American soldier, during the War of Independence, using his powder horn to prime the pan of his flintlock musket, engraved by A. Bollett (engraving) by Darley, Felix Octavius Carr (1822-88) (after); Private Collection; (add.info.: American Revolutionary War (1775-83); ); Peter Newark Pictures; American, out of copyright
